Skip to content

Instantly share code, notes, and snippets.

View sasha240100's full-sized avatar
💭
Working remotely

Alexander Buzin sasha240100

💭
Working remotely
View GitHub Profile
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
material: {
kind: "basic", // Material type.
// Three.js properties.
color: 0xff0000,
opacity: 0.5,
transparent: true,
side: THREE.DoubleSide
}
WHS.API.extend({
bannanas: 10,
apples: 15,
pineapples: 20
}, {
apples: 10,
chocolate: 12
});
{
bannanas: 10,
apples: 15,
pineapples: 20,
chocolate: 12
}
new THREE.BoxGeometry(
params.geometry.width,
params.geometry.height,
params.geometry.depth
);
new THREE.SphereGeometry(
params.geometry.radius,
params.geometry.segmentA,
params.geometry.segmentB
);
new THREE.PlaneGeometry(
params.geometry.width,
params.geometry.height,
params.geometry.segments
);
new THREE.CylinderGeometry(
params.geometry.radiusTop,
params.geometry.radiusBottom,
params.geometry.height,
params.geometry.radiusSegments
);
new THREE.DodecahedronGeometry(
params.geometry.radius,
params.geometry.detail
);
new THREE.IcosahedronGeometry(
params.geometry.radius,
params.geometry.detail
);